Company and business law disputes can arise in a number of different areas. For example, there may be a dispute over directors’ remuneration, shareholders may be unhappy with the way the company is being run, or there may be deadlock in the company’s decision making.

Disputes can divert much needed time and resources away from the running of your business and it is therefore important to seek legal advice as soon as possible should disagreements arise.

A clearly drafted Shareholders’ Agreement can minimise the risk of disputes arising and where appropriate we work with our Company/Commercial team who provide advice in this area.
